5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While on-line poker brings many benefits, it isn't without its challenges. Among major disadvantages may be the possibility fraudulent activities, including collusion and chip dumping, in which people cheat to achieve an unfair benefit. But reputable on-line poker platforms employ sturdy safety actions and random number generators to thwart such behavior. Furthermore, some players could find the lack of real cues and communications which can be section of live poker games a disadvantage, as they can be harder to read through opponents and employ mental strategies online.
